The official music video for Mareux 's "The Perfect Girl," directed by Muted Widows and starring drag superstar Violet Chachki, is a masterclass in modern darkwave aesthetics. Released on April 20, 2022, the visual reinterprets Mareux's viral cover of The Cure's 1987 track through a lens of fetish culture, mid-century noir, and surrealist isolation.
